首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用Service Broker API在Cloud Foundry中提供特定于服务实例的凭据?

在Cloud Foundry中,Service Broker API是一种用于管理服务实例的机制。它允许开发人员通过API调用来创建、绑定和解绑服务实例,并获取与服务实例相关的凭据。

要在Cloud Foundry中使用Service Broker API提供特定于服务实例的凭据,可以按照以下步骤进行操作:

  1. 创建服务实例:首先,使用Service Broker API的create-service-instance端点创建一个服务实例。这将触发服务经纪人的创建过程,并为该服务实例生成唯一的标识符。
  2. 绑定服务实例:使用Service Broker API的bind-service-instance端点将服务实例绑定到应用程序。这将生成一个包含凭据的绑定对象,以便应用程序可以访问服务。
  3. 获取凭据:通过解析绑定对象,应用程序可以获取与服务实例相关的凭据。凭据可能包括用户名、密码、API密钥等,这取决于所使用的服务。
  4. 使用凭据:应用程序可以使用获取到的凭据来访问所需的服务。例如,如果服务是数据库服务,应用程序可以使用凭据连接到数据库并执行操作。

需要注意的是,Service Broker API的具体实现可能会因云服务提供商而异。以下是一些常见的云服务和腾讯云相关产品示例:

  • 数据库服务:腾讯云数据库MySQL、腾讯云数据库MongoDB等。可以通过Service Broker API创建和绑定这些数据库服务实例,并获取相应的凭据。具体产品介绍和链接地址可参考腾讯云官方文档。
  • 缓存服务:腾讯云云数据库Redis等。通过Service Broker API创建和绑定Redis服务实例,并获取相应的凭据。腾讯云官方文档中有详细的产品介绍和链接地址。
  • 消息队列服务:腾讯云消息队列CMQ等。使用Service Broker API创建和绑定CMQ服务实例,并获取相应的凭据。腾讯云官方文档提供了产品介绍和链接地址。

通过使用Service Broker API,在Cloud Foundry中可以方便地为特定的服务实例提供凭据,使应用程序能够轻松地与所需的服务进行集成和交互。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券